Bank Stocks Slide as Anthropic Profits, Oil Prices Rise on Middle East Risks

Market Overview
Global markets traded around four major themes on Monday.
First, U.S. bank stocks led Wall Street lower. Bank of Americas CEO warned that third-quarter trading revenue is likely to remain roughly flat, while investment banking revenue is expected to fall short of expectations. The stock closed down more than 5%, while Goldman Sachs dropped nearly 4%. The S&P 500 fell 0.48% to 7,619.98, the Dow Jones Industrial Average declined 0.29%, and the Nasdaq Composite lost 0.56%. Meanwhile, U.S. core CPI for August came in slightly above expectations, pushing the 10-year Treasury yield briefly above 5.0% intraday.
Second, AI leader Anthropic posted a profit for the second consecutive quarter. Second-quarter revenue surged fourteenfold year over year to $11.5 billion. The company has reportedly selected Nasdaq for its listing, with its valuation potentially reaching as high as $2 trillion. Anthropic also signed a $13.7 billion computing capacity agreement with Rum Group.
Third, Middle East supply risks escalated sharply. An oil tanker struck a mine and exploded in the Strait of Hormuz, while Houthi forces launched a large-scale attack on a Saudi air base. WTI crude settled 1.34% higher at $101.39 per barrel, while Brent crude gained 1.02% to $105.68.
This week, the focus in U.S. equities is shifting toward the banking sector and the interest-rate outlook. Bank of America‘s warning on trading and investment banking revenue, combined with slightly hotter-than-expected core CPI and the 10-year Treasury yield approaching 5%, has intensified debate over the earnings outlook for financial stocks and the Federal Reserve’s policy path in the second half of the year.
Forward guidance from other major banks will therefore be closely watched. Treasury Secretary Scott Bessents testimony before the House Financial Services Committee could also influence market sentiment and broader risk appetite.
AI Capital Spending and the Battle for Computing Capacity
Anthropic has now delivered profits for two consecutive quarters while securing a major long-term computing capacity agreement. At the same time, Nvidia and Palantir are reportedly restricting the use of their models, highlighting how cooperation and competition are intensifying simultaneously across the AI value chain.
SoftBank has repaid ahead of schedule the bridge loan used to finance its investment in OpenAI, while Kioxia is considering raising capital in the U.S. Capital continues to flow toward AI computing infrastructure and data storage. In the next phase of the AI investment cycle, companies that can secure long-term access to critical computing resources are likely to hold greater pricing power.
